企業概要

BEST SPAC I Acquisition Corp. is a shell company entity that does not currently engage in significant operational activities but is structured specifically to effect a merger, share exchange, asset acquisition, stock purchase, reorganization, or similar business combination with one or more private or public businesses in the future. The company operates within the Financial Services sector and is classified under the industry of Shell Companies, a designation that reflects its transitional status as an unaffiliated corporation awaiting a target business combination rather than an active operating firm. BEST SPAC I Acquisition Corp.について

BEST SPAC I Acquisition Corp. does not have significant operations. It intends to effect a merger, share exchange, asset acquisition, stock purchase, reorganization, or similar business combination with one or more businesses. The company was incorporated in 2024 and is based in Hong Kong, Hong Kong.
